
By Gabriela Baron
Free bus rides going to Philippine Arena will be offered to fans who will watch Gilas Pilipinas’ opening game against Dominican Republic.
Tournament organizers will be deploying 400 49-seater buses from 12 strategic take off points:
- PITX
- MOA Arena
- One Ayala
- BGC Market Market Bus Terminal
- Araneta
- Trinoma
- Clover Leaf Ayala
- SM Mega Mall
- SM North
- SM Pampanga
- SM Baliwag
The free shuttle bus rides are scheduled to depart from each boarding terminal at 11:00 a.m. and 12 noon, and hourly from 1:00 p.m. to 5:00 p.m.
The Philippines is eyeing to set a new attendance record on the opening game between Gilas Pilipinas and Dominican Republic.
It is eyeing to break the highest attendance recorded at the FIBA World Cup set during the 1994 finals between the United States and Russia in Toronto, Canada at 32,616.
